Browsing Vetlexicon

1. To begin browsing, click on a species icon on the top right of the screen or click the Knowledge Center link to show labeled species icons. Select the species you wish to explore.

2. Once on the species page, select the topic you wish to browse.

 

3. Within each topic, content is separated into Articles, Factsheets, Images, PDFs, Videos, and Tables. Select the tab for the content you wish to view.

Searching Vetlexicon

1. To search Vetlexicon, enter your search term in the search box at the top right of the website.

2. The search results page will return all the content related to your search. Narrow your search by species and/or content type by selecting the appropriate filters to the left of the search results.

 

3. Within text articles, scroll down to view all the content or click the heading for the content section you wish to view.

4. Within the resource page, any related content is listed by type in a column to the right of the resource currently being viewed. To view the related content, simply click on the link to the new content you wish to view.

Faculty Use in Instruction

Faculty may use the Vetlexicon image and video resources in lectures, but the images/videos must be shown from within the Vetlexicon site. If you are using screenshots, the screenshot must include the Vetlexicon logo.
